Magento初试 Magento在阿里云服务器的测试


Magento是一款优秀的电子商务系统,且又是开源的。如果是做外贸的话,Magento应该是不二的电子商务系统选择。

magento

当然作为中文网站也是可以的,Magento的中文语言包官网也有提供,也很容易下载到。只是还没完全汉化,目前汉化的质量也有些问题,大部分是没问题,少部分还是需要后期再做优化。如果要做一次适合中文用户浏览习惯的电子商务,那估计还是需要花些时间在汉化上。现在很多翻译都是直译,有些时候并不通顺。

Magento的速度慢也是一直被讨论的话题,不过有好的服务器再+适当的优化,Magento的速度也是可以令人满意的。

Magento服务器选择

这次用的是阿里云服务器(点这里),1核CPU,1G内存,2M带宽,Centos 64位系统。经过2天的测试,大致的感觉就是有点慢。查看了服务器的统计信息,CPU够用,带宽够用,但内存明显不够了:

Mem: 1018804k total,  951520k used,  67284k free

可用的内存真的不多。Magento实在太耗资源了。

用阿里服务器最大的好处就是随时可以升级,任意升级。1G内存不够,那就升到2G内存,重启下服务器就搞定了。升到2G内存后,用了一天后,再用top看看资源的情况。

Mem:  1920944k total, 1840872k used, 80072k free

我都彻底凌乱了。2G内存又所剩不多了。这是咋的了?? 有多少资源,Magento就吃多少?苦逼啊。

继续再观察看看吧。

 

更新

好吧。上面top的数据没有把cached的数据也一起放出来。那就不准了。再用free -m看看

#free –m
                                total       used       free     shared    buffers     cached
Mem:                        1875       1720        155          0        149        180
-/+ buffers/cache:      1390        484
Swap:                        0          0          0

Swap还没有。 从这个来看也占了1390M的内存了。还是得继续找找优化的文章参考参考。


3条回应:“Magento初试 Magento在阿里云服务器的测试”

  1. [root@Imcat ~]# free -m
    total used free shared buffers cached
    Mem: 499 490 8 0 13 195
    -/+ buffers/cache: 281 217
    Swap: 511 147 364

    实际使用率也就280M多少。linux系统是有多少内存就缓存多少内存的。